Output 6ad39a8dcc71d52b9677760ded7812a21cd7aa38afb162606636f8111e69c06f:0

value
62740
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e496e533b2bffae8f43e0b8e923e8544df2dbdbd OP_EQUALVERIFY OP_CHECKSIG
address
1Mqfq8RXTVio6wvSyZtBWKpeDZnp8xuHvf
transaction
6ad39a8dcc71d52b9677760ded7812a21cd7aa38afb162606636f8111e69c06f
confirmations
394861
spent
true